Transaction 4dc5ca105bd79ca6f9096f79cf1c6805da4c9ff816c7a2eed826e091604fb838

2 Input
1 Outputs
  • 4dc5ca105bd79ca6f9096f79cf1c6805da4c9ff816c7a2eed826e091604fb838:0
  • value  2689847
    address  3E3UpQoU3412gstVupx4Zg9q46fPDbig2u